About Zacualpan

Zacualpan is a small town in Mexico (Colima) with a population of 1,905. The city sits at an elevation of 2,136 feet (651 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 73°F (23°C). Temperatures range from 67°F in January to 75°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 35.9 inches. The timezone is America/Mexico_City.

Nearby Volcanoes

2 volcanoes within 200 km. Closest: Colima (27 km).

Name Type Elevation Last Eruption Distance
Colima Stratovolcano(es) 3,850 m (12,631 ft) 2019 27 km
Mascota Volcanic Field Pyroclastic cone(s) 2,560 m (8,399 ft) Unknown 175 km
Source: Smithsonian Institution Global Volcanism Program (GVP). Sorted by distance.
